/*
===================================================
SURFACE INSPECTOR
===================================================
*/
si_globals_t g_si_globals;
// make the shift increments match the grid settings
// the objective being that the shift+arrows shortcuts move the texture by the corresponding grid size
// this depends on a scale value if you have selected a particular texture on which you want it to work:
// we move the textures in pixels, not world units. (i.e. increment values are in pixel)
// depending on the texture scale it doesn't take the same amount of pixels to move of GetGridSize()
// increment * scale = gridsize
// hscale and vscale are optional parameters, if they are zero they will be set to the default scale
// NOTE: the default scale depends if you are using BP mode or regular.
// For regular it's 0.5f (128 pixels cover 64 world units), for BP it's simply 1.0f
// see fenris #2810
void DoSnapTToGrid( float hscale, float vscale ){
g_si_globals.shift[0] = static_cast<float>( float_to_integer( static_cast<float>( GetGridSize() ) / hscale ) );
g_si_globals.shift[1] = static_cast<float>( float_to_integer( static_cast<float>( GetGridSize() ) / vscale ) );
getSurfaceInspector().queueDraw();
}
void SurfaceInspector_GridChange(){
if ( g_si_globals.m_bSnapTToGrid ) {
DoSnapTToGrid( Texdef_getDefaultTextureScale(), Texdef_getDefaultTextureScale() );
}
}

class FaceTexture
{
public:
TextureProjection m_projection;
ContentsFlagsValue m_flags;
Plane3 m_plane;
std::size_t m_width;
std::size_t m_height;
FaceTexture() : m_plane( 0, 0, 1, 0 ), m_width( 64 ), m_height( 64 ) {
m_projection.m_basis_s = Vector3( 0.7071067811865, 0.7071067811865, 0 );
m_projection.m_basis_t = Vector3( -0.4082482904639, 0.4082482904639, -0.4082482904639 * 2.0 );
}
};
FaceTexture g_faceTextureClipboard;
void FaceTextureClipboard_setDefault(){
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_flags = ContentsFlagsValue( 0, 0, 0, false );
TexDef_Construct_Default(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_projection );
}
void TextureClipboard_textureSelected( const char* shader ){
FaceTextureClipboard_setDefault();
}
void Face_getTexture( Face& face, CopiedString& shader, TextureProjection& projection, ContentsFlagsValue& flags ){
shader = face.GetShader();
face.GetTexdef( projection );
flags = face.getShader().m_flags;
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ane = face.getPlane().plane3();
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_width = face.getShader().width();
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_height = face.getShader().height();
}
typedef Function4<Face&, CopiedString&, TextureProjection&, ContentsFlagsValue&, void, Face_getTexture> FaceGetTexture;
void Face_setTexture_Seamless( Face& face, const char* shader, const TextureProjection& projection, const ContentsFlagsValue& flags ){
face.SetShader( shader );
DoubleLine line = plane3_intersect_plane3(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ane, face.getPlane().plane3() );
if( vector3_length_squared( line.direction ) == 0 ){
face.ProjectTexture(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_projection,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al() );
face.SetFlags( flags );
return;
}
Quaternion rotation = Quaternion( vector3_cross(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al(), face.getPlane().plane3().normal() ),
static_cast<float>( 1.0 + vector3_dot(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al(), face.getPlane().plane3().normal() ) ) );
//Quaternion rotation = quaternion_for_unit_vectors(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al(), face.getPlane().plane3().normal() );
//rotation.w() = sqrt( vector3_length_squared(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al() ) * vector3_length_squared( face.getPlane().plane3().normal() ) ) + vector3_dot(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ane.normal(), face.getPlane().plane3().normal() );
//globalOutputStream() << "rotation: " << rotation.x() << " " << rotation.y() << " " << rotation.z() << " " << rotation.w() << " " << "\n";
//quaternion_normalise( rotation );
const double n = ( 1.0 / sqrt( rotation[0] * rotation[0] + rotation[1] * rotation[1] + rotation[2] * rotation[2] + rotation[3] * rotation[3] ) );
rotation = Quaternion(
static_cast<float>( rotation[0] * n ),
static_cast<float>( rotation[1] * n ),
static_cast<float>( rotation[2] * n ),
static_cast<float>( rotation[3] * n )
);
//globalOutputStream() << "rotation: " << rotation.x() << " " << rotation.y() << " " << rotation.z() << " " << rotation.w() << " " << "\n";
Matrix4 transform = g_matrix4_identity;
matrix4_pivoted_rotate_by_quaternion( transform, rotation, line.origin );
// Matrix4 transform = matrix4_rotation_for_quaternion_quantised( rotation );
// Vector3 translation;
// translation_for_pivoted_matrix_transform( translation, transform, line.origin );
// transform.tx() = translation.x();
// transform.ty() = translation.y();
// transform.tz() = translation.z();
//globalOutputStream() << "transform: " << transform << "\n";
TextureProjection proj = projection;
proj.m_brushprimit_texdef.addScale(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_width,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_height );
Texdef_transformLocked( proj,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_width,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_height,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ane, transform, line.origin );
proj.m_brushprimit_texdef.removeScale( g_faceTextureClipboard.m_width, g_faceTextureClipboard.m_height );
//face.SetTexdef( projection );
face.SetTexdef( proj );
face.SetFlags( flags );
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_plane = face.getPlane().plane3();
g_faceTextureClipboard.m_projection = proj;
}
